タグ

urlに関するbasiのブックマーク (8)

  • PHP25行で書くURL短縮プログラム:phpspot開発日誌

    Writing your own URL shortener in 25 lines of PHP :: Jaisen Mathai PHP25行で書くURL短縮プログラムが公開されています。 案外簡単なので、自分用に使いやすくカスタマイズして公開してみるのもよいかもしれません。 SQLスキーマ、mod_rewriteの設定についても書かれています。 関連エントリ URLを短くできるTinyURLのAPIPHPから簡単に使える「PEAR::Services_TinyURL」 TinyURLよりも短いURLが作れるURL短縮サービス「u.nu」 分かりやすいURL短縮化サービス『Shorty』

    basi
    basi 2009/06/14
  • URL最適化5つのSEOポイント | エンジニアのためのSEO入門

    前回の記事では検索エンジン全体の仕組みをおさらいし、その中でもクローラーの動きに着目しました。最新の情報を検索結果に反映させるためには、クローラーになるべく多くの回数自社サイトを訪問してもらい、ページの内容を適切な情報としてインデックスしてもらう必要があります。 このインデックスの際に重要なのが、サイトに対するクローラーの回遊性「クローラビリティ」です。クローラビリティを向上させる要素の1つとして、URLの最適化があげられます。SEOには、キーワードやカテゴリの設計、HTMLの最適化、外的施策などさまざまな対策が考えられますが、その中でもURLの最適化は、最も重要な要素の1つです。いくら他の対策が完璧でも、URLの設定によってはいい効果が期待できません。 一口にURLの最適化といってもさまざまです。この連載では、以下の3つの方法を説明していくことにしたいと思います。 永続化 ←この記事で解

    URL最適化5つのSEOポイント | エンジニアのためのSEO入門
  • URLを短くするサービスを提供できるPHPスクリプト「Phurl」:phpspot開発日誌

    Phurl - PHP URL Shortening Script URLを短くするサービスを提供できるPHPスクリプト「Phurl」がオープンソースで公開されています。 置いておくだけでも便利なのですが、WIKIのようなURLが長くなるような部分に組み込んで、自動で短くしてしまうのも便利かもしれませんね。 関連エントリ URLを短くできるTinyURLのAPIPHPから簡単に使える「PEAR::Services_TinyURL」 URLを短くするサービスを提供するためのスクリプト

  • 短縮したURLを生成する·Phurl MOONGIFT

    URLはGoogleをはじめとした検索エンジンの登場によって、さほど大きな意味を持たなくなってきている。覚える必要もなく、検索して出てくれば良い。だが、時には覚える必要があったりして、その場合には長いURLは覚えづらいものになってしまう。 長いURLを短縮したURLを生成する そうした時に便利なのがtinyurlをはじめとしたURL短縮サービスだ。だがtinyurlの場合は飛び先が問題のある可能性もありちょっと怖い。そこでオリジナルで立ててしまえば安心だ。 今回紹介するオープンソース・ソフトウェアはPhurl、PHP+MySQLのURL短縮サービスだ。 Phurlはtinyurl同様に短くしたURLを生成するWebサービスを構築できる。URLは誰でも生成できるが、CAPTCHAによる人であることの証明を行うようにもできる。画像生成に対応していないWebサーバであればreCAPTCHAを使う

    短縮したURLを生成する·Phurl MOONGIFT
  • 短いURLを生成する·Shorty MOONGIFT

    twitterのような文字数制限をするサービスとtinyurlの組み合わせはとても相性が良い。ただ、オンラインだけでのやり取りであればURLの形はさほど気にならないが、紙や電話でURLを伝えるとなるとよく分からない文字の羅列は厄介だ。 URL生成 そこで分かりやすいURLを生成できるWebサービスを立ち上げよう。ただ短いものとはまた違って便利なはずだ。 今回紹介するフリーウェアはShorty、短縮URL生成サービスだ。PHPなのでソースコードは開示されているがオープンソース・ソフトウェアではないのでご注意いただきたい。 Shortyはtinyurlとは異なり、ユーザ登録を行う必要がある。手間と感じざるを得ないが、生成したURLごとのクリック数を記録、閲覧するためと思われる。そもそもパブリックなものであればtinyurlを使えば良いので、その点は別物として考えれば良いだろう。 効果測定 生成

    短いURLを生成する·Shorty MOONGIFT
  • Splicd · Get Straight To The Point

    MySQL Query : SELECT id,pinyin,title,thumb,description FROM `xbqxw`.`ol_jingdian` WHERE 1=1 ORDER BY rand() LIMIT 4 MySQL Error : Got error 28 from storage engine MySQL Errno : 1030 Message : Got error 28 from storage engine Need Help?

  • 未来のURL短縮サービスを一足先に使える「Bit.ly」

    他にもすばらしい機能がいくつか搭載されているが、これはほんの手始めだ。近いうちに、JavaScriptで記述されたブックマークレット、ユーザーアカウントが利用可能になる予定だ(最新情報:Bit.lyはつい最近、シンプルなブックマークレットを追加した。今後はさらに気軽に使えるように使えるようになる)。 Bit.lyの未来:意味解析と地理空間解析 Bit.lyは、ReutersのOpen Calais意味解析APIを使って、ユーザーがショートカットを作成したすべてのページをバックグラウンドで解析している。Calaisは以前の記事で大々的に取り上げたことがある。Bit.lyは、Calaisを使って、ユーザーがショートカットを作成したすべてのページの一般カテゴリとテーマを特定する。開発者コミュニティーは、XML、JSON APIを使って、この情報を無料で入手できる。 それだけではないと言わんばかり

    未来のURL短縮サービスを一足先に使える「Bit.ly」
  • URLを短くできるTinyURLのAPIをPHPから簡単に使える「PEAR::Services_TinyURL」:phpspot開発日誌

    URLを短くできるTinyURLのAPIPHPから簡単に使える「PEAR::Services_TinyURL」 2007年10月15日- PEAR :: Package :: Services_TinyURL PHP interface to TinyURL's API URLを短くできるTinyURLのAPIPHPから簡単に使える「PEAR::Services_TinyURL」。 URLを短くするサービスとしては最も有名であるTinyURLですが、このAPIPHPから簡単に呼び出せます。 APIを呼び出すと具体的には、URLを短くしたり、TinyURL化されたURLのとび先を調べることも出来ます。 具体的な使い方は以下。 <?php require_once 'Services/TinyURL.php'; // URLをtinyurl化する $tiny = new Services

    basi
    basi 2007/10/18
  • 1